茶叶中稀土总量的快速测定法

摘    要:根据ICP—MS法分析的茶叶中稀土组成,以La∶Ce∶Nd∶Y∶Pr=40∶25∶20∶8∶7混合的稀土为标样,采用湿法灰化和偶氮胂Ⅲ为显色剂,在紫外—可见分光光度计656nm处测定茶叶中的稀土总量。该方法快速简便,适于基层卫生防疫部门大批量快速检测茶叶中稀土总量时应用。文中还对该方法与国标法、萃取分光光度法及ICP—MS法进行了比较,并对该方法的注意事项进行了讨论。

Method of Quickly Analyzing Rare Earth Content in Tea

Abstract:The present analyzing methods of rare earth (RE) can not satisfy the requirement of quickly and conveniently analyzing large amounts of tea samples in epidemic prevention stations.A new method of RE determination in tea sample (ASM arsenazoⅢ spectrophotometer method) was offered in this paper,with the mixed RE elements (La∶Ce∶Nd∶Y∶Pr=40∶25∶20∶8∶7) as standard,acid digestion method was used,arsenazoⅢ used as color developing reagent,and edtermined by the ultraviolet visible spectrophotometer under λ656nm.It was characterized with quickness and simplicity.This method can satisfy the requirement of analyzing RE content with quickness and convenience.The method was compared with national standard method(NSM),arsenazoⅢ_extracting spectrophotometer method(AESM)and ICP_MS method.Details about the method were discussed also.
